Touchstone Development held an open house at Kirkland Performance Center on Thursday, February 21st to discuss the status of the new Park Place development. The event was well-attended with about 100 attendees. Touchstone management described the layout of the development which includes 1.2 million square feet of office space and triple the amount of retail space. Since only 6% retail spending by Kirkland residents is spent in Kirkland, Touchstone hopes their development will increase that number. The amount of workers increases from about 500 to 6000 people while parking increases from 1000 spaces to 3500 spaces. Touchstone goals are for a beautiful space with walkways connecting Peter Kirk Park with 45% of the acreage devoted to public areas (that includes streets and street parking). It will take 30 months to build the first phase and 24 months for the second phase. Two seven story buildings and one eight story building are included in the plan. The city council will need to approve building height variances to approve their plan. Most questions from the attendees revolved around parking, traffic, and the retail mix.
